Is bottleneck calculator legit?

This is a question our experts keep getting from time to time. Now, we have got the complete detailed explanation and answer for everyone, who is interested!

Bottleneck calculators are simple tools that anyone can use to determine whether or not the hardware they intend to install into their computer will work well together. Nevertheless, these calculators are not 100% accurate, so you should still do some independent research as well.

What is the logic behind bottleneck calculators?

The Bottleneck Calculator is a tool that may be used to evaluate the connection that exists between your computer’s processor and its graphics card. The power-gap between the central processing unit (CPU) and the graphics processing unit (GPU) of your computer is determined by these tools. Be sure to check that neither the processor nor the graphics card that you intend to purchase will result in a performance bottleneck.

Is the backlog really that serious of an issue?

A bottleneck, in and of itself, is not necessarily a negative thing, because in reality, every system does have at least one bottleneck. Prior to the rise of solid-state drives (SSDs), the hard disk had been the most significant bottleneck. There is always going to be one part that drags down the performance of the others.

Is 100 CPU utilization bad?

If the percentage of CPU being used is close to or at 100%, this indicates that the computer is attempting to complete more work than it is capable of doing. This is often acceptable, but it does mean that the programs you run might become slightly less efficient. While performing tasks that require a significant amount of processing, such playing games, a computer’s processor will typically be used at or near its maximum capacity.

How can I tell whether I’m creating a bottleneck?

To your relief, there is a simple test you can do to determine whether or not you will experience a CPU bottleneck: As you are playing a game, keep an eye on the loads on both the CPU and the GPU. If the load on the CPU is extremely high (about 70 percent or higher) and is noticeably higher than the load on the visual card, then the CPU is the source of the bottleneck.

Is Valorant more demanding on the CPU or the GPU?

VALORANT has an full team that is dedicated to ensuring the game’s continued success and enhancing its current capabilities. In VALORANT, PCs with lower specifications are more likely to be GPU bound (meaning that rendering will be the process that limits your frame rate), whereas machines with middle to high specifications are more likely to be CPU bound.

What is an acceptable amount of RAM?

The vast majority of users will only require roughly 8 gigabytes of RAM, but if you intend to use many applications all at once, you may require 16 gigabytes or more. Your computer will be difficult to use and your applications will experience delays if you do not have adequate RAM. Although having sufficient memory is essential, adding more of it won’t necessarily result in a noticeable performance boost in all cases.

Does CPU have an effect on FPS?

Does CPU have an effect on FPS? Your frame rate per second (FPS) will be affected by the capabilities of your CPU; however, the influence of your GPU will be significantly greater. Your central processing unit (CPU) and graphics processing unit (GPU) need to find a happy medium in order to avoid becoming a bottleneck. Having a good central processing unit (CPU) is still very important, despite the fact that it won’t have as big of an impact.

Is it possible for RAM to generate bottlenecks?

The term “memory bottleneck” refers to a situation in which the computer does not have adequate or quick enough RAM… In situations in which the currently installed RAM cannot keep up with the demands of the system, its functionality must be upgraded; on the other hand, capacity bottlenecks can be resolved by simply installing additional memory.

Is 90 CPU temp bad?

The temperature of 90 degrees Celsius is excessive; under gaming demands, the temperature of the CPU shouldn’t go above 80 degrees. You might try cleaning the stock cooler of dust and reapplying the thermal paste before you decide to replace the original cooler. Due to the fact that the CPU has been around for a few years, the thermal paste that is already on the CPU may have dried out.

Is 80 degrees Celsius hot for a CPU?

During gaming, the optimal temperature for the central processing unit (CPU) is between between 75 and 80 degrees Celsius. The temperature of the computer should not exceed 60 degrees Celsius when it is in a state of idleness or when it is performing simple activities. It should be between 45 and 60 degrees Celsius at the most.
